Re: [問題] property/synthesize之後...

看板MacDev作者 (狗狗)時間14年前 (2009/12/27 23:57), 編輯推噓0(000)
留言0則, 0人參與, 最新討論串4/7 (看更多)

12/27 00:46,
不過蠻好奇的 會使用setA:nil來relase的特殊情況有哪些
12/27 00:46

12/27 00:46,
如果有實際例子能夠提供的話 小弟感激不盡
12/27 00:46

12/27 11:22,
GC
12/27 11:22
感謝zonble大有稍微解了我一點疑惑 所以意思是指 使用setA:nil來release舊物件 並且不讓指標指向舊物件 好讓GC可以找出已經沒在用的memory leak物件來釋放記憶體嗎? 但是 我是在書上看到作者在- (void)didReceiveMemoryWarning下面 對沒有在使用的物件使用setA:nil的方式來release 可是這是在iPhone上實作這個方法來release不要的物件 iPhone上又沒有GC 那使用setA:nil來release還會有其他先前沒有提到的好處嗎? -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 203.77.52.127
文章代碼(AID): #1BDuFYsn (MacDev)
討論串 (同標題文章)
文章代碼(AID): #1BDuFYsn (MacDev)